Description
This group experiment is suited for distance learning and class use! Using readily available materials, this speed lab/experiment is the perfect accompaniment to a unit on Motion.
Presented with a problem, students will develop a hypothesis, gather data, make measurements, perform calculations, graph data and analyze results by answering a few questions.
The included template has guidelines, an answer key for the teacher, and printable lab sheets and directions for students.
